[Remote] Senior Program Manager
Note: The job is a remote job and is open to candidates in USA. American AgCredit is a national financial organization dedicated to supporting agriculture. They are seeking a Senior Program Manager responsible for developing and executing strategic programs that align with the company’s top initiatives, working closely with leadership to ensure successful outcomes.
Responsibilities
- Plan and direct one or more cross-functional strategic initiatives. These initiatives will be high visibility and large, complex, and strategic in scale
- In partnership with leadership, define the scope and objectives of each initiative and achieve Stakeholder and team buy-in of objectives
- Drive execution of initiatives working with team to develop actionable program roadmaps and milestones. Helps with estimation and drives resource planning
- Understand Project and Software Delivery Lifecycles and project/program best practices
- Build, develop, and maintain strategic, cross-functional stakeholder relationships by identifying key partnerships across the company
- Ensure appropriate engagement by Process and Enterprise Architecture, Change Enablement, Technology and Business Stakeholders
- Evaluate program performance by comparing objectives to actual results, identifying, measuring, and analyzing key performance indicators (KPIs), and trend data
- Understand program risks and issues and manages appropriately
- Effectively communicate initiative progress to executive leadership, Association management, and general staff
- Partner with Change Enablement team and champion standards of effective change
